Plex Documentation → Remote Access & Granting Library Access
→ Setting Up Remote Access
→ Troubleshooting Remote Access
Plex Forums: The Basics of Remote Access Troubleshooting
Remote access is never working.
When Plex initially says remote access is working, it is really just trying to enable it. When that process fails, usually after about 30 seconds, it returns to the “not available..” message.
For remote access to work, your router must support either UPnP or port forwarding.
Your other devices are most likely connecting via Plex Relay. The stream is tunneled through a server at Plex and id limited to 2 Mbps.
Monitor streaming via Plex Dashboard → Now Playing + Expanded View.
If the connection is Indirect, then it is using Plex Relay.